MOBILE OPENS UP REGION XIII MEN’S SOCCER TOURNEY WITH 4-1 WIN

     MOBILE, Ala. – The 9th-ranked UM men’s soccer team (13-4) opened up the first round of the 2003 Region 13 tournament with a 4-1 win over Southern Wesleyan University (8-12). The win sends the Rams to the semi-finals to be played at home on Wednesday, Nov. 12.

The Rams, who out-shot their opponent 16-9, first got on the board in the 10th minute. A ball played into the 18 yard box was headed on by All-American defender Jamie Ferguson and put away by Darren Toby.

Scott Yadon scored in the 14th minute, giving Mobile a 2-0 advantage, as the Warriors were unable to clear a corner kick played in by Ruben Risco.

The tandem of Ferguson and Toby struck again in the 23rd minute as the defender from New Castle, England played in a quick free kick which the Trinidad national team member drove to goal to give UM a 3-0 lead at the half.

Southern Wesleyan’s Andrey Molina scored their only goal of the night as his direct kick in the 70th minute ricocheted off of Mobile’s defense.

Mobile scored their final goal of the night in the 83rd minute. Making his return after missing the last month due to injury, Johani Koivuranta weaved through the Warrior’s defense and scored unassisted.
